The latest polymer pistol magazine out from Magpul is the PMAG 12 GL9, a 12-round magazine designed for use in the Glock 26.

The new PMAG 12 uses the same technology and designs found in the popular PMAG 17 and PMAG 15 and provides owners of the Glock 26 with two extra rounds in magazine capacity, along with a built-in finger groove to improve grip.

The magazine also features grooves molded into the side of the magazine's base to aid users in retrieving the mag from the pistol. The magazine also features an easily removable floor plate that uses a paint-pen marking matrix that allows owners to label magazines to aid in organization and maintenance.

The new PMAG 12 GL9 is available in black and retails at a suggested price of $15.95.
